Image 1 of 3
158 CHF
Import duties included
One Size available
Estimated delivery
Mar 13 - Mar 16
Highlights
- dark green
- patch
- adjustable strap
- curved peak
Composition
Cotton 100%
Product IDs
FARFETCH ID: 33001669
Brand style ID: BCM003705C00001
158 CHF
Import duties included
One Size available
Estimated delivery
Mar 13 - Mar 16
Cotton 100%
FARFETCH ID: 33001669
Brand style ID: BCM003705C00001